Managing Member Histories and Revisions<br />

Default Branch specifies the starting point of the default<br />

branch. To specify a default branch, enter a branch number<br />

in the Default Branch field, for example, 2.1.1.<br />

Compressed specifies if the archive is compressed. To<br />

compress the archive, select the Compressed checkbox.<br />

Strict Locking specifies if a strict locking policy is in effect<br />

for the archive. To enable strict locking, select the Strict<br />

Locking checkbox.<br />

Store by Reference causes each revision to be saved to a<br />

separate file, instead of saving all revisions to one file. This<br />

feature improves performance for archives that contain<br />

large binary files. To store the archive by reference, select<br />

the Store by Reference checkbox.<br />

Archive Description describes the archive. If necessary,<br />

enter or edit a description.<br />

<strong>The</strong> Labels tab displays a list of revision labels in the archive,<br />

for example, Draft1 1.1.<br />

<strong>The</strong> Locks tab displays a list of users who have locks on<br />

revisions in the archive, for example, gmiller 1.2.<br />

3 To save your changes, click OK. To cancel the operation, click<br />

Cancel.<br />

<strong>The</strong> archive information is saved.<br />

To view archive information in the command line interface<br />

Use the si archiveinfo command, for example:<br />

where<br />

si archiveinfo --sandbox=value member<br />

value specifies the path and name of the sandbox containing the<br />

member whose archive information you want to view, for<br />

example, c:/sandboxdemo/project.pj<br />

member specifies the member whose archive information you<br />

want to view, for example, demoapp.ico<br />

V<strong>Sky</strong> <strong>Software</strong> <strong>Manager</strong> displays the member’s archive<br />

information, for example:<br />

Member Name: c:/sandboxdemo/demoapp.ico<br />

Sandbox Name: c:/sandboxdemo/project.pj<br />
